Benefits of Using Letter B Worksheets

Using Letter B worksheets can have numerous benefits for children. For one, they can help kids develop their phonemic awareness, which is the ability to hear and manipulate individual sounds in words. This skill is essential for reading and spelling, and it can be developed through activities such as tracing, coloring, and matching letters. Additionally, Letter B worksheets can help children develop their fine motor skills, as they learn to write and draw the letter B correctly.

How to Use Letter B Worksheets Effectively

To use Letter B worksheets effectively, it’s essential to make them a part of a larger learning plan. This can include reading books that feature the letter B, singing songs and reciting nursery rhymes that highlight the sound of the letter, and engaging in activities that involve the letter B, such as baking bread or playing with balls. By incorporating Letter B worksheets into a comprehensive learning plan, children can develop a deeper understanding of the alphabet and improve their overall literacy skills.

Tips for Creating Your Own Letter B Worksheets

If you’re looking for ways to create your own Letter B worksheets, there are several tips to keep in mind. First, make sure to keep the worksheets simple and easy to understand, especially for younger children. Use large fonts and colorful images to make the worksheets visually appealing, and include a variety of activities, such as tracing, coloring, and matching, to keep children engaged. You can also use online tools and templates to create custom worksheets that fit the needs of your child or students.
